Biography

I have been in journalism in some form or another since 2016 but my desire to spread truthful and thought-provoking messages began long before then. I played a journalist in a school drama project at the age of 10 and wrote a weekly newsletter for my cousins about our imaginary world. At the age of 13 I began a YouTube channel to share my life and my friendships, but as I got older I decided to try and make more structured and researched content. At 22 I am a recent English Language graduate from the University of Manchester who has been heavily involved in the Students' Union since day one. I ran for Part Time Trans Officer in my first year and again in my third, which was when I was elected into the role. Alongside my studies I have also been writing and vlogging. I didn't write for the student newspaper as I always wanted to provide an alternative perspective from theirs. I have written for TenEighty, Her Campus, the University of Manchester student news, my own Medium page and I even got myself a byline in The Guardian whilst on work experience. I specialise in LGBTQ+ issues, especially trans issues, film, TV, student politics, new media and e-sports and gaming. I am excited to take the next step in my journalism career!

  • The new Overwatch game mode takes a leaf out of League of Legends' book, and it looks amazing

    By Daz Skubich| Pocket Tactics Verified Overwatch 2 is leaning into its origins as a MOBA-inspired shooter with its all-new game mode, Overwatch 2 Stadium. This 5v5 seven-round brawl lets you buy items and equip passives mid-match, much like League of Legends and other traditional MOBAs.Since its initial launch, Overwatch 2 has faced strong competition from some of the other best FPS games and hero shooters, but it’s finally starting to pull away from the pack thanks to the new Stadium game mode.
